Right now I have installed Octave from the binary at SourceForge.net
and all the package I need except Image. Image requires ImageMagick.
So I used MacPorts to port ImageMagick and then tried to install the
Image package from octave.sourceforge.net, but got the errors shown
below. Does anyone know what is going on?

Do you have the development files for ImageMagick installed?
Specifically, you need the C++ headers. That's called something like
libmagick++, although I'm not sure of the name.
